Summary

Urban growth and climate change together complicate planning efforts meant to adapt to increasingly scarce water supplies. Several studies have shown the impacts of urban planning and climate change separately, but little attention has been given to their combined impact on long-term urban water demand forecasting. Here we coupled land and climate change projections with empirically-derived coefficient estimates of urban water use (sum of public supply, industrial, and domestic use) to forecast water demand under scenarios of future population densities and climate warming. Purpose

This data was generated as part of the stakeholder-driven assessments of water availability supported by the National Water Census Focus Area Studies: Coastal Carolinas. For local and regional decision makers, land use planners, and their stakeholders this data can provide a better understanding of the implications of their planning and development choices on future water needs.
